The National Eligibility Test (NET) which is conducted to test the basic eligibility for college/university lectureship will be done so, by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E) from this year onwards. NET has earlier been conducted by University Grants Commission (UGC). The entrance is conducted twice the year round.
The responsibility of conducting the entrance was transferred from UGC to CBSE, on grounds of it not being able to conduct the exam smoothly.
With this addition made to its list of exams, CBSE has become the nation’s largest educational body to be conducting exams. The total number of candidates taking the exams conducted by CBSE has been increased to more than sixty five lakhs from around sixty three lacks due to NET being added to this list.
CBSE is also responsible for many other national examinations such as; Class X & XII board exams, Class X proficiency test, Pre-Medical Entrance Test, Joint Engineering Entrance (JEE) (mains) and also Central Teachers Eligibility Test apart from the newly added NET.
From the year 2013, December entrance of NET, there has been an increase by 25% in the number of candidates who had taken the test in June this year.
